Holiday Crafting with Magnolias

Do you like to take your craft with you on holidays? I do! I miss my creative time if I don’t take it with me.

Currently I am away interstate visiting with my Mum. She is 85 now and resides in an aged care facility. There are a lot of activities in the home, which Mum likes to participate in when she is feeling up to it, but she does sleep a fair bit too. I utilise the quiet times by crafting, while she naps. Her tray table in her room is my work surface, which is a small space, so I keep everything compact and organised.
I usually take along my basic tool kit, paper trimmer, adhesives, black inks, Stampin’ Shammy, a Stamp Set and my water colour pencils. This time I have also brought along the Magnolia Lane Memories & More Cards and Memories & More Specialty Cards and Envelopes.

I made this card yesterday for my Aunty, which I can give to her tomorrow when she comes to visit Mum. I love catching up with my extended family when I am here.


For the inside, I used one of the Memories & More journaling cards to make a pretty insert to write my greeting.


This card was a really quick and easy card to make, with minimal supplies. I love that the Memories & More Cards can be used for both memory keeping and card making.
